a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orBenedikt Peetz <benedikt.peetz@b-peetz.de>2025-02-21 22:33:31 +0100
committerBenedikt Peetz <benedikt.peetz@b-peetz.de>2025-02-21 22:33:31 +0100
commit832ad8265015284f1d95c3426f074aaeacd05864 (patch)
tree65dd99a206d0fdb54cc4d4a109489eed073468f6
parentchore(crates/libmpv2): Make `cargo clippy` happy (diff)
downloadyt-832ad8265015284f1d95c3426f074aaeacd05864.zip
chore(crates/yt_dlp/wrappers/info_json): Add further fields
Diffstat (limited to '')
-rw-r--r--crates/yt_dlp/src/wrapper/info_json.rs4
1 files changed, 3 insertions, 1 deletions
diff --git a/crates/yt_dlp/src/wrapper/info_json.rs b/crates/yt_dlp/src/wrapper/info_json.rs
index 4b80245..a2c00df 100644
--- a/crates/yt_dlp/src/wrapper/info_json.rs
+++ b/crates/yt_dlp/src/wrapper/info_json.rs
@@ -762,6 +762,7 @@ pub struct Format {
pub height: Option<u32>,
pub http_headers: Option<HttpHeader>,
pub is_dash_periods: Option<bool>,
+ pub is_live: Option<bool>,
pub language: Option<String>,
pub language_preference: Option<i32>,
pub manifest_stream_number: Option<u32>,
@@ -809,9 +810,10 @@ pub struct HttpHeader {
#[derive(Debug, Deserialize, Serialize, PartialEq, PartialOrd)]
#[serde(deny_unknown_fields)]
pub struct Fragment {
- pub url: Option<Url>,
pub duration: Option<f64>,
+ pub fragment_count: Option<usize>,
pub path: Option<PathBuf>,
+ pub url: Option<Url>,
}
impl InfoJson {